NC Soldiers at Inauguration Today

Soldiers and airmen from the North Carolina National Guard are helping today with the presidential inauguration just as they assisted four years ago. The Guard has sent two explosive ordnance disposal teams as well as a contingent to help with the defense of computer networks. In all, more than a dozen North Carolina Guard members are taking part in today's event. North Carolina also has helicopters and additional support personnel on standby should inaugural planners need them to make the trip to Washington, D.C. One week ago, several Guard members traveled to Washington to discuss preparations for the event, which will take place today on the grounds of the U.S. Capitol. In January of 2009, the North Carolina National Guard sent communications specialists and other personnel to Washington to support the first inaugural ceremony for President Barack Obama. Also, National Guard personnel from more than two dozen states are working on this year's inaugural event.
